I've just had a call from John from the company, just to reiterate what donss said above.
Another large test is scheduled between 1200 and 1400 on Friday, with a final test on Saturday, that will be smaller than the one today and fridays test.
Seems that they rely on the landowner to publicise the testing, and that this does not appear to have happened this time. The testing is taking place within 200 metres of a building, and a noise level of 118dB was recorded for todays test.
The noise may be getting transmitted more than expected due to the low cloud and the sandstone on which much of caithness sits. The test site is right at the edge of the sandstone and it seems to be transmitting the sound more than expected.

This is the reply I got to my email, pretty much the same as others.......
On behalf of Ordnance Test Solutions Limited we would like to apologies for any distress and concerns that has been caused to you on the recent explosions that have been carried out within the Strathmore Estate.
We were scheduled to carry out four firings of the magnitude heard, this has now been reduced to three with the third scheduled to take place on Friday 5th August between the hours of 1200hrs and 1400hrs. with one or two minor firings on Saturday 6th August.
It is not the intention of the company to disturb and upset the local community and we do apologies to the community for not being informed of the tests being carried out and that reasonable notice was not provided by the Strathmore Estate or ourselves.
The Thurso police were notified of our intentions
